2009–2010
On December 10, 2009, Rovio launched Angry Birds on the App Store for iOS devices.
2010–2020
On October 15, 2010, the wordmark was slightly tweaked when Angry Birds was released on Google Play for Android devices.
This wordmark was continued to be used on Angry Birds Rio, Star Wars and Star Wars II until discontinued on February 3, 2020 due to licensing issue.
2015–present
This wordmark first appeared in Angry Birds 2, which was released on July 30, 2015.
On July 29, 2019, the original Angry Birds video game, known as "Angry Birds Classic", as well as Seasons, Space, Go! and Epic, was discontinued in order to focus on the newer titles.
